Various other celebrities whose homes were targeted in the Hollywood criminal offense spree consisted of Paris Hilton, Lindsay Lohan and Orlando Flower. The participants of the “Bling Ring”– Rachel Lee, Nick Prugo, Alexis Neiers, Courtney Ames and Diana Tamayo– swiped about $ 3 million in complete in personal belongings and money.
Lee, called the team’s ringleader, was punished to 4 years in jail yet just offered 16 months, while Neiers was in jail for greater than a month and Prugo offered one year.
The real-life tale additionally came to be the emphasis of a number of films and docuseries, consisting of Life time’s The Bling Ring, the Sofia Coppola-directed movie The Bling Ring, HBO’s The Ringleader: The Situation of the Bling Ring and Netflix’s The Actual Bling Ring: Hollywood Break-in.
